Overview:
This dual-course bundle combines two vital areas of modern governance—Certificate in Compliance and Diploma in Anti-Money Laundering (AML). Together, they provide a structured route through regulatory expectations and the growing demand for financial transparency. From understanding the duties of regulated businesses to interpreting reporting obligations and high-risk indicators, this pairing offers strong foundational insight suitable for many professional contexts.

The Certificate in Compliance covers ethical decision-making, legal boundaries, and policy interpretation. Meanwhile, the Diploma in AML focuses on suspicious activity, global frameworks, and methods used to detect and deter illicit finance. Whether your interest lies in understanding industry standards or contributing to the prevention of financial crime, these courses are designed to give clarity without jargon. Learn the importance of documentation, diligence, and sound judgement—without leaving your seat.

Career Path:

  • AML Analyst – £35,000 per year
  • Compliance Officer – £42,000 per year
  • Risk Analyst – £45,000 per year
  • Financial Crime Investigator – £38,000 per year
  • Governance & Policy Assistant – £33,000 per year
  • KYC (Know Your Customer) Specialist – £36,000 per year
